{ "info": { "author": "Justus 'slyphiX' Henneberg", "author_email": "slyphiX@users.noreply.github.com", "bugtrack_url": null, "classifiers": [ "Development Status :: 4 - Beta", "Intended Audience :: Education", "License :: Free For Educational Use", "License :: Free For Home Use", "Operating System :: OS Independent", "Programming Language :: Python :: 3" ], "description": "### quickdemo - For When Unit Tests Would Be Too Much\n\n*Work In Progress - Interfaces might change in the future!*\n\n`quickdemo` is a tiny python library for quick prototyping and code\ndemonstrations. If your debugging tool of choice is printing to `stdout`,\nthis might well be the right library for you.\n\nThere may be times when you only need to demonstrate that a function works on\na few well-chosen inputs. In that case, it might suffice to just call the\nfunction with your test input and print the results.\n\nHowever, during early prototyping your function interface might change very\nrapidly and you would have to adjust your print statement every time your\nfunction call changes. Or perhaps you would like to provide multiple\nequivalent implementations of the same function that share the same signature\nand run all your test on all of them.\n\nFortunately, there is a way to ease this tedious task.\n`quickdemo` offers function decorators that will call the decorated function\nusing the supplied arguments when the file is run and print the result (if any).\n\n\n", "description_content_type": "text/markdown", "docs_url": null, "download_url": "", "downloads": { "last_day": -1, "last_month": -1, "last_week": -1 }, "home_page": "https://github.com/slyphiX/quickdemo", "keywords": "", "license": "", "maintainer": "", "maintainer_email": "", "name": "quickdemo", "package_url": "https://pypi.org/project/quickdemo/", "platform": "", "project_url": "https://pypi.org/project/quickdemo/", "project_urls": { "Homepage": "https://github.com/slyphiX/quickdemo" }, "release_url": "https://pypi.org/project/quickdemo/0.0.6/", "requires_dist": null, "requires_python": "", "summary": "Small Python library for quick prototyping and code demonstrations", "version": "0.0.6" }, "last_serial": 5146821, "releases": { "0.0.1": [ { "comment_text": "", "digests": { "md5": "601efdcde9d5800f336e5862532e61bb", "sha256": "d5929412c80f55a7c4576a41c5e29c5b3e1bd6a49ecb8847e662fd7733a421d6" }, "downloads": -1, "filename": "quickdemo-0.0.1-py3-none-any.whl", "has_sig": false, "md5_digest": "601efdcde9d5800f336e5862532e61bb", "packagetype": "bdist_wheel", "python_version": "py3", "requires_python": null, "size": 4684, "upload_time": "2019-02-05T21:33:33", "url": "https://files.pythonhosted.org/packages/44/3e/71a37a382f087c4a8fe6fe4bf21f6f43a9c3ac0b868d3bf3992443cc8636/quickdemo-0.0.1-py3-none-any.whl" }, { "comment_text": "", "digests": { "md5": "ba7eb67816959621e55f96e785de078c", "sha256": "82616e5c04ccea54e63d227d4e0a55b989fe02de12dddbca69499d041c374430" }, "downloads": -1, "filename": "quickdemo-0.0.1.tar.gz", "has_sig": false, "md5_digest": "ba7eb67816959621e55f96e785de078c", "packagetype": "sdist", "python_version": "source", "requires_python": null, "size": 4007, "upload_time": "2019-02-05T21:33:34", "url": "https://files.pythonhosted.org/packages/85/57/3682133cfbea2283a0af2193c039b0e5393adb16696c78d459b44d1baec7/quickdemo-0.0.1.tar.gz" } ], "0.0.2": [ { "comment_text": "", "digests": { "md5": "ac2fc1a0e55f445b8bd56ce078eafe01", "sha256": "3c7c85a90bad5d1210b1257c17a805fe43f7faaa14e2c313b90e2d078c76eabe" }, "downloads": -1, "filename": "quickdemo-0.0.2-py3-none-any.whl", "has_sig": false, "md5_digest": "ac2fc1a0e55f445b8bd56ce078eafe01", "packagetype": "bdist_wheel", "python_version": "py3", "requires_python": null, "size": 4776, "upload_time": "2019-02-05T21:41:37", "url": "https://files.pythonhosted.org/packages/00/5c/017aad044a06662497c4764bb736516cb8846fbf0c0be8c1a8e0fada74e9/quickdemo-0.0.2-py3-none-any.whl" }, { "comment_text": "", "digests": { "md5": "b81154752a1d7eabdd76969eed4f1b65", "sha256": "00c2537e4a062270d8cbcf8c4f00bad6aedb40df54b9e244f626753a8361c9fa" }, "downloads": -1, "filename": "quickdemo-0.0.2.tar.gz", "has_sig": false, "md5_digest": "b81154752a1d7eabdd76969eed4f1b65", "packagetype": "sdist", "python_version": "source", "requires_python": null, "size": 4081, "upload_time": "2019-02-05T21:41:39", "url": "https://files.pythonhosted.org/packages/7e/3f/97357fe2223906b3fdb6cffc5388da98017323a66c9a7530c5af14d7d634/quickdemo-0.0.2.tar.gz" } ], "0.0.3": [ { "comment_text": "", "digests": { "md5": "6b0ea9ab8b6ff033ad151a6fa4323135", "sha256": "ae387036488d68ca28745b15ffdf2b01210323dc655b56f026786bd756438dcf" }, "downloads": -1, "filename": "quickdemo-0.0.3-py3-none-any.whl", "has_sig": false, "md5_digest": "6b0ea9ab8b6ff033ad151a6fa4323135", "packagetype": "bdist_wheel", "python_version": "py3", "requires_python": null, "size": 4780, "upload_time": "2019-02-05T22:01:17", "url": "https://files.pythonhosted.org/packages/84/ac/273fa97ceed15a607b8df58346f85a05e397f42c20ef9e5496cec4443ce9/quickdemo-0.0.3-py3-none-any.whl" }, { "comment_text": "", "digests": { "md5": "0c32a7a166e2ceb2cbc6afaf62c3039c", "sha256": "cee1eba8bb5c1d452e762b5ea38ad2f25803798b311684ecc60a3abb4e604d2f" }, "downloads": -1, "filename": "quickdemo-0.0.3.tar.gz", "has_sig": false, "md5_digest": "0c32a7a166e2ceb2cbc6afaf62c3039c", "packagetype": "sdist", "python_version": "source", "requires_python": null, "size": 4088, "upload_time": "2019-02-05T22:01:18", "url": "https://files.pythonhosted.org/packages/55/ae/f4b2152e6f159f785963e2036388ccbd8c4dd058578b37c5f1fbed70ba91/quickdemo-0.0.3.tar.gz" } ], "0.0.4": [ { "comment_text": "", "digests": { "md5": "1e95ab1dac8567b9dad78023663dfa33", "sha256": "fc62059a159481362553b15446c3c2a0dbf19021bd6456cb6f730c8dd05c677e" }, "downloads": -1, "filename": "quickdemo-0.0.4-py3-none-any.whl", "has_sig": false, "md5_digest": "1e95ab1dac8567b9dad78023663dfa33", "packagetype": "bdist_wheel", "python_version": "py3", "requires_python": null, "size": 4775, "upload_time": "2019-02-05T22:41:10", "url": "https://files.pythonhosted.org/packages/11/e6/26fe5d305a1b181d812afd53638ad250ed70d350317628e33ddc5ba00743/quickdemo-0.0.4-py3-none-any.whl" }, { "comment_text": "", "digests": { "md5": "55822570e96649bd1396a50b24b567c6", "sha256": "4d8b24d120a07e340c64244db600b9c25f5d943bf379ba09e62643b00c81c7ca" }, "downloads": -1, "filename": "quickdemo-0.0.4.tar.gz", "has_sig": false, "md5_digest": "55822570e96649bd1396a50b24b567c6", "packagetype": "sdist", "python_version": "source", "requires_python": null, "size": 4079, "upload_time": "2019-02-05T22:41:11", "url": "https://files.pythonhosted.org/packages/af/01/5a87067abdaffbc1d46a8b40245662acc8333688051fb1ff5116ec5af414/quickdemo-0.0.4.tar.gz" } ], "0.0.5": [ { "comment_text": "", "digests": { "md5": "7016d479051044619560295493eb9cfd", "sha256": "12ee3385d266b17dd0a4b313f28bdd26b4fce920bf88fd0556a59e8bc732f960" }, "downloads": -1, "filename": "quickdemo-0.0.5-py3-none-any.whl", "has_sig": false, "md5_digest": "7016d479051044619560295493eb9cfd", "packagetype": "bdist_wheel", "python_version": "py3", "requires_python": null, "size": 4894, "upload_time": "2019-02-06T21:43:13", "url": "https://files.pythonhosted.org/packages/7d/de/40f6ec3d0b187be2c60f76441a039f5a9df65b2827025d60c3068a1535a0/quickdemo-0.0.5-py3-none-any.whl" }, { "comment_text": "", "digests": { "md5": "b5e2dc69b3fed3d380032ad6e75bafe2", "sha256": "4641faa68361ca56966248417930a0995eae50c8115091834f0d2a24bd65d9a9" }, "downloads": -1, "filename": "quickdemo-0.0.5.tar.gz", "has_sig": false, "md5_digest": "b5e2dc69b3fed3d380032ad6e75bafe2", "packagetype": "sdist", "python_version": "source", "requires_python": null, "size": 4215, "upload_time": "2019-02-06T21:43:14", "url": "https://files.pythonhosted.org/packages/de/d4/fd4fce8e60ab9133d5c5562172d411610e0d5c6527d6c9763d1d828f2698/quickdemo-0.0.5.tar.gz" } ], "0.0.6": [ { "comment_text": "", "digests": { "md5": "2d7172d771075d6d2b6cb3cf2c224161", "sha256": "905b2c51ba9571ce83ef5544c2df3041468eda955ead294e229808214d8c44a0" }, "downloads": -1, "filename": "quickdemo-0.0.6-py3-none-any.whl", "has_sig": false, "md5_digest": "2d7172d771075d6d2b6cb3cf2c224161", "packagetype": "bdist_wheel", "python_version": "py3", "requires_python": null, "size": 5056, "upload_time": "2019-04-15T21:17:49", "url": "https://files.pythonhosted.org/packages/ed/51/d793f7721b21d7e52a0e678584ba63d49afdbf5a8a9e832a94218e82aaf0/quickdemo-0.0.6-py3-none-any.whl" }, { "comment_text": "", "digests": { "md5": "a5d2927504a0f42de7e3c34135aeae8c", "sha256": "98b7032fd8863ce73f71a329bb028301c0c6cdf76f3c09cf7a704e419a19702b" }, "downloads": -1, "filename": "quickdemo-0.0.6.tar.gz", "has_sig": false, "md5_digest": "a5d2927504a0f42de7e3c34135aeae8c", "packagetype": "sdist", "python_version": "source", "requires_python": null, "size": 4349, "upload_time": "2019-04-15T21:17:50", "url": "https://files.pythonhosted.org/packages/16/27/6f55049e002335d270fe5307587d073fee9cfe5aab1a3f4753f53d6ac33d/quickdemo-0.0.6.tar.gz" } ] }, "urls": [ { "comment_text": "", "digests": { "md5": "2d7172d771075d6d2b6cb3cf2c224161", "sha256": "905b2c51ba9571ce83ef5544c2df3041468eda955ead294e229808214d8c44a0" }, "downloads": -1, "filename": "quickdemo-0.0.6-py3-none-any.whl", "has_sig": false, "md5_digest": "2d7172d771075d6d2b6cb3cf2c224161", "packagetype": "bdist_wheel", "python_version": "py3", "requires_python": null, "size": 5056, "upload_time": "2019-04-15T21:17:49", "url": "https://files.pythonhosted.org/packages/ed/51/d793f7721b21d7e52a0e678584ba63d49afdbf5a8a9e832a94218e82aaf0/quickdemo-0.0.6-py3-none-any.whl" }, { "comment_text": "", "digests": { "md5": "a5d2927504a0f42de7e3c34135aeae8c", "sha256": "98b7032fd8863ce73f71a329bb028301c0c6cdf76f3c09cf7a704e419a19702b" }, "downloads": -1, "filename": "quickdemo-0.0.6.tar.gz", "has_sig": false, "md5_digest": "a5d2927504a0f42de7e3c34135aeae8c", "packagetype": "sdist", "python_version": "source", "requires_python": null, "size": 4349, "upload_time": "2019-04-15T21:17:50", "url": "https://files.pythonhosted.org/packages/16/27/6f55049e002335d270fe5307587d073fee9cfe5aab1a3f4753f53d6ac33d/quickdemo-0.0.6.tar.gz" } ] }